Output 514c21dcc84f1676543b713a9cc6346fbdce00da3c6aa3845d41261e10328056:1

value
161775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d22d28a05a7c5ad38e423f27dece47e4f61029 OP_EQUAL
address
34E7x31p8BQaMVszp3nGP4KWzpHt4MX9Gi
transaction
514c21dcc84f1676543b713a9cc6346fbdce00da3c6aa3845d41261e10328056
confirmations
174613
spent
true